-
查看详细错误信息:测试失败通常会提供详细的错误信息和堆栈跟踪。首先查看这些信息,以了解失败的原因。
-
理解失败原因:根据错误信息,理解测试失败的具体原因。可能的原因包括代码逻辑错误、依赖项问题、测试数据问题等。
-
检查测试代码:检查你的测试代码,确保它们覆盖了正确的场景,并且没有逻辑错误。有时候测试用例本身可能存在问题。
-
查看被测代码:如果测试涉及到被测代码,确保被测代码的实现符合预期逻辑。
-
查找并修复问题:根据测试失败的具体原因,修改代码以解决问题。这可能涉及到修复逻辑错误、调整测试用例、修复依赖项或测试环境的问题等。
-
重新运行测试:在修改后,重新运行测试以确保问题已经解决。
-
持续集成/持续部署(CI/CD)环境中的处理:如果你的项目使用CI/CD管道,确保在提交代码时自动运行测试。在这种情况下,确保所有测试通过后再进行部署或合并代码。
最简单的:
直接去掉测试 此做法用的人比较多